About

Dirty Heads are a reggae rock band from Huntington Beach, California. Consisting of lead vocalists and founders Jared Watson (Dirty J) and Dustin Bushnell (Duddy B), along with percussionist Jon Olazabal, drummer Matt Ochoa and bassist David Foral, the band was formed in 2001 and immediately evoked the spirit of bonfire barbeques and summer road trips. Dirty Heads’ appeal is rooted in the infectious reggae grooves of songs like 2017’s “Vacation,” which became a viral hit in 2021 as the sound behind the #VacationTransition trend on TikTok. The band’s breakthrough hit was another “song of the summer” contender: “Lay Me Down” (feat. Rome of Sublime with Rome), which reached No. 1 on the Billboard Alternative Songs and Rock Songs charts. In 2021, the band released The Best of Dirty Heads, a compilation album featuring Travis Barker, Aimee Interrupter of The Interrupters, Matisyahu, Train, Tech N9ne and Rome. Dirty Heads have hit the road with artists such as 311, O.A.R., Gym Class Heroes and Lupe Fiasco, and more.
